Indian equity markets are currently at an important technical crossroads, with the Nifty 50 testing crucial support levels after failing to sustain momentum above recent highs. According to technical analysts at HDFC Securities, the benchmark index remains vulnerable to short-term volatility but continues to hold above a strong cluster of support levels that could determine the next major market move.

While broader market sentiment has turned cautious following the recent correction, stock-specific opportunities continue to emerge. HDFC Securities has highlighted Gland Pharma and Viyash Scientific as two stocks exhibiting strong bullish chart patterns and favorable technical indicators, making them attractive candidates for traders seeking opportunities in a consolidating market.

The coming sessions are expected to be critical as investors assess whether the Nifty can defend key support levels or witness further downside pressure.

Nifty Fails to Sustain Above Key Resistance

The market's recent weakness began after Nifty failed to decisively break above the important resistance zone near 24,190.

Following the rejection at higher levels, the benchmark index slipped below its immediate swing low, signaling a loss of short-term momentum and increasing caution among traders.

Support Cluster Remains Strong

Despite the recent decline, analysts believe the Nifty continues to trade within a strong support region that could help stabilize market sentiment.

Important Support Levels

Key technical supports are currently placed at:

  • 50-Day Exponential Moving Average (DEMA): 23,825
  • 20-Day Exponential Moving Average (DEMA): 23,750
  • 38.2% Fibonacci Retracement Level: 23,761
  • 50% Fibonacci Retracement Level: 23,630

The convergence of multiple technical indicators in the same region strengthens the probability of support emerging around these levels.

Gap Zone Provides Additional Cushion

Another important factor supporting the market is the presence of a previously formed price gap.

The Nifty has entered a gap support zone created during the sharp rally witnessed earlier in June.

Why Gap Supports Matter

Gap zones often act as:

  • Demand areas
  • Institutional buying zones
  • Technical support levels
  • Potential reversal regions

The current gap support between 23,645 and 23,817 is therefore being closely monitored by market participants.

As long as the index remains above this range, analysts believe the broader uptrend remains intact.

What Happens If Support Breaks?

While the market continues to hold key support levels, analysts caution that a decisive breakdown could accelerate selling pressure.

Downside Risk Levels

If Nifty closes below 23,630:

  • Selling momentum could intensify
  • The next target could be near 23,500
  • Volatility may increase across sectors

This level coincides with the 61.8% Fibonacci retracement of the previous rally and is considered a crucial line of defense for bullish investors.

Gland Pharma Shows Strong Bullish Breakout

Pharmaceutical major Gland Pharma has emerged as one of the preferred technical picks based on its recent chart behavior.

Technical Highlights

Current Market Price: ₹2,290

Target Price: ₹2,500

Stop Loss: ₹2,150

According to analysts, the stock has delivered a breakout from a bullish Inverted Head and Shoulders pattern on the monthly chart.

Additionally, it has also broken out from a Flag pattern on the daily chart.

Why the Pattern Matters

The Inverted Head and Shoulders pattern is widely considered a powerful bullish reversal signal.

It often indicates:

  • End of a prolonged correction
  • Resumption of an uptrend
  • Improving investor sentiment
  • Strong accumulation activity

The breakout gains further credibility because it is accompanied by rising trading volumes.

Viyash Scientific Displays Cup-and-Handle Breakout

Another stock highlighted by HDFC Securities is Viyash Scientific, which has recently completed a classic bullish chart formation.

Technical Highlights

Current Market Price: ₹267

Target Price: ₹294

Stop Loss: ₹260

The stock has broken out from a Cup-and-Handle pattern on the weekly chart, a formation often associated with sustained upward movements.

Understanding the Cup-and-Handle Pattern

This pattern typically indicates:

  • Strong accumulation
  • Gradual trend formation
  • Investor confidence
  • Potential continuation of an uptrend

The breakout is considered particularly significant because it occurred alongside strong volume expansion.

Technical Indicators Confirm Strength in Viyash Scientific

Multiple momentum indicators continue to support the positive outlook for the stock.

Key Technical Signals

Analysts note:

  • Weekly RSI remains above 50
  • Weekly MACD has crossed above equilibrium
  • MACD remains above the signal line
  • Stock trades above key moving averages

Together, these indicators suggest strengthening momentum and improving trend quality.
